An Architect III is a licensed professional who exercises a high level of independent judgment in the design, planning, and coordination of architectural projects. This role includes technical and design leadership, limited project management, and mentorship of junior staff. Architect III staff are expected to contribute to project delivery across all phases, support client and consultant coordination, and assist firm leadership in advancing quality and innovation.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ities- Lead the development of design and technical solutions for assigned projects.
- Manage project documentation and coordinate across all phases (Schematic Design, Design Development, Construction Documents, and Construction Administration).
- Coordinate with clients, consultants, and contractors; may serve as day-to-day contact on smaller projects.
- Lead and coordinate small project teams (typically 1–3 staff members), assembled from across the firm for specific projects, ensuring collaboration and quality in assigned work.
- Mentor interns and Architect I–II staff, supporting professional growth.
- Review drawings, specifications, and deliverables for accuracy and compliance.
- Conduct code and zoning research and ensure adherence to applicable regulations.
- Oversee quality control and contribute to firm-wide technical standards.
- Contribute to proposals, interviews, and marketing efforts in collaboration with senior staff.
- Support firm leadership on design direction and operational goals.
- Share expertise in specific building types or project sectors.
